  • Patent number: 9254841
    Abstract: A method includes determining failure of a drive energy store of a vehicle and activating generator operation of a electric main engine as a result of the failure. The method includes determining a current driving condition of the vehicle, what actuators are necessary in order to put the vehicle into a safe operating condition, and what each of the necessary actuator dynamics are based on the current driving condition of the vehicle. The method includes determining a demand for electrical energy that is necessary for a particular necessary actuator to attain the safe operating condition, and regulating a proportionate generator operation of the electric main engine, taking into consideration electrical energy of the necessary actuators required for carrying out each of the necessary actuator dynamics. The method includes activating the actuators necessary for achieving the safe operating condition with the determined actuator dynamics until the safe operating condition is achieved.

  • Publication number: 20140095026
    Abstract: A method of setting an optimized distance for inductive charging between a coil system of an inductive charging station and a coil system of an electric vehicle includes determining, by the inductive charging station, the optimized distance and calculating position data based on the optimized distance determined. The method also includes transferring the calculated position data to the electric vehicle and calculating a suspension construction for the electric vehicle based on the position data. The method includes transferring data on the calculated suspension construction to a suspension control device of the electric vehicle.

  • Patent number: 7393887
    Abstract: A composition and process is disclosed for the stabilization of halogen-containing polymers. In particular, chlorine-containing polymers such as poly vinyl chloride (PVC) are stabilized by incorporating of a stabilizer mixture having at least a perchlorate salt and an alkanolamine.
